About

I started as an Electronics & Telecommunication engineer — soldering boards, writing firmware, and making sensors and motors agree with each other. The deeper I went, the more I realized the hardest, most important problems weren't in any single layer. They lived in the seams: between a protocol and its implementation, between a model and the system it controls, between what a device can do and what it should be trusted to do.

That pulled me toward security. Today, as an MSISPM student at Carnegie Mellon's Heinz College, I work across applied and embedded security, post-quantum cryptography, and AI security — with one foot still firmly in building real systems: robots, drones, digital twins, and the infrastructure around them.

I also build organizations. I founded the thinkMINNT Foundation and have led national-scale technical initiatives. I care about work that is rigorous enough to publish and concrete enough to ship.
